Neighborhood Overview

Nestled in Auburn, Massachusetts, X Fire Paintball is situated within the broader Worcester County area. The venue is located off Southbridge Road, a primary artery for local traffic and access to surrounding communities. Its location offers a balance of rural accessibility and proximity to urban centers like Worcester. The nearest major airport is Worcester Regional Airport (ORH), roughly a 20-minute drive, with Boston Logan International Airport (BOS) being a more distant but common option for out-of-town travelers, approximately an hour's drive depending on traffic. Navigating to the site is straightforward via MA Route 12, which connects to larger state highways. Parking is ample and located directly on-site, designed to accommodate participant vehicles. For those arriving via rideshare or taxi, the main entrance on Southbridge Road is the designated drop-off point. Peak traffic can occur during weekday rush hours and weekend event times, so planning your arrival 30-45 minutes before your scheduled game is advisable to account for check-in and gear-up processes.

Outing Day Flow

Arrival & Pre-Event

Plan your arrival at least 45 minutes prior to your scheduled game time. This allows ample time for check-in, signing waivers, and renting necessary equipment like masks, markers, and protective gear. The staff will guide you through safety protocols and the rules of the field. Familiarize yourself with the staging areas and the layout of the facility before the games begin. Waiting for your designated game slot to start is a good time to hydrate and mentally prepare for the action ahead.

During the Event

Once your game begins, follow the field marshals' instructions and adhere strictly to safety rules, such as keeping your mask on at all times in playing zones. Communicate with your teammates and strategize on the fly. Take advantage of any mid-game breaks to rehydrate, reload paint, and discuss tactics for the next round. Be aware of the time remaining in each game to manage your resources effectively.

Weather & Seasons

❄️

Winter

Winter in Auburn brings cold temperatures, often with snow and ice. Daytime highs may struggle to get above freezing, and nights are frigid. Visitors should bundle up in heavy, insulated clothing, including hats, gloves, and waterproof boots. Outdoor activities are limited, and driving conditions can be challenging due to snow and ice on roads. Layering is essential for any brief outdoor exposure.

🌱

Spring & early summer

Spring brings gradually warming temperatures, with a mix of sunny days and intermittent rain. Highs typically range from the 50s to the 70s Fahrenheit. Early summer continues this trend with pleasant conditions, averaging in the 70s. Light layers, including long-sleeved shirts and a light jacket, are practical. Comfortable footwear is key for outdoor activities. Rain gear is advisable, as showers can be frequent.

☀️

Mid-summer

Mid-summer is characterized by warm to hot and humid weather, with daytime highs frequently in the 80s and occasionally reaching the 90s Fahrenheit. Humidity can make it feel even warmer. Light, breathable clothing is recommended. Staying hydrated is crucial, so carrying water is essential for any outdoor exertion. Sunscreen and hats are highly advisable to protect against strong UV rays.

🍂

Fall season

Fall offers crisp, cool air and progressively colder temperatures as the season advances. Daytime highs start in the 60s and 70s in early autumn and drop into the 40s and 50s by late fall. The foliage provides a beautiful scenic backdrop. Layers are essential, starting with a base layer and adding a sweater or fleece, and a jacket for cooler days. Long pants and comfortable closed-toe shoes are standard.

📅

Rain & snow

Rain is common throughout the year, particularly in spring and fall, often arriving with cooler temperatures. Snowfall is typical from late fall through winter, with accumulations varying year to year but capable of causing travel disruptions. Visitors should always check local weather forecasts before traveling and be prepared for changes. Waterproof outerwear and appropriate footwear are recommended during periods of rain or snow.
